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
Check carefully that you don't have a sharp object hiding in your hand luggage. Other banned items include flammable or explosive substances, such as fuel and matches, and liquids and gels in containers with a capacity of more than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).
What to wear on a flight:
Comfort should be your top priority when deciding what to wear on board. Loose clothing is a smart option, as are flat, slightly roomy shoes.
You've probably he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by prolonged periods of sitting. To lower your risk on board, drink plenty of water, consider wearing compression socks and move your lower limbs often.
How to get through airport security fast when flying to Agia Varvara?
A little pre-planning before you get to the airport can make your getaway to Agia Varvara easy and painless. Check out our useful tips for a stress-free journey past security:
Security personnel first need to establish that you have a valid ID and matching travel documents before anything else. Have them in your hand, ready for inspection.
Your jacket, belt, keys and other items in your pocket, like your earph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as your turn draws near.
Your electronic devices like laptops and phones will also have to go through the machine for inspection. Don't worry though, you'll be back online in no time.
Remember to remove gels and liquids from your hand lu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
It's also possible you'll be asked to take your shoes off for scanning,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a clever idea.
Sharp items are not allowed in the cabin. They'll be seized at security, so put them in your checked bags.
